You may be able to use home equity to spend for the remodelling. If you have a lot of residence equity, a residence equity car loan or HELOC would enable you to utilize your house as collateral as well as obtain against its value to spend for the remodel. Borrowing against home equity can be less pricey and less of a hassle than taking out a new home mortgage as well. The lender will certainly make use of a loan-to-value ratio to identify your lending quantity.

There will be times when the residential or commercial property is empty as well as you do not have any type of rental fee coming in so you need to have a contingency fund to meet your mortgage settlements when this occurs. There can also be occasions when the renters remain yet stop paying lease. You still have to pay your mortgage every month and, if you failed, you can shed the residential or commercial property altogether. Do fixer upper clients keep Clint's furniture?

Gaines stages every 'Fixer Upper' home

As is the case for most HGTV shows, the clients don't typically get to keep the furniture or decorations. Their budget usually only allots for renovations. Otherwise, all of the furniture gets removed from the home after filming.

How do people pay home renovations?

Home Equity Loan or Line of Credit (HELOC)

A home equity loan is the classic way to finance home renovations. Take out a loan against the equity in your own house. Lower interest rates than personal loans and credit cards. Large amounts of money may be available for large projects like additions.
